I hope that we can sort things out,
We do much more than scream and shout.
I hope we see what we did wrong,
And find more ways to get along.
I hope the ocean becomes clean,
So fish and dophins still are seen.
I hope pollution is finally stopped
And fewer tress are actually chopped.
I hope the glaciers remain strong,
So polar bears thrive where they belong.
I hope the future gets a chance,
So we can do a future dance.
This short poem outlines the sense of hope that I have during a time of genuine uncertainty. Fingers crossed that we can really begin to deal with global warming and take strides towards improving our environment for animals and humans.
